Originally Posted by scoobywrc
Can someone please tell me what the safe speed option is.
snip>
RAC Trackstar Plus is more than just a vehicle security system - it can also improve your safety on the road, too. Using the same Global Positioning Satellite (GPS) technology employed to track the vehicle, other services can be provided to the motorist.

There are over 6,000 safety cameras installed on UK roads today and this number is continuing to grow. They are often located at accident black spots to reduce speed and prevent accidents. Interestingly, in a Mori survey it was found that motorists using speed camera detection devices travelled over 50% more miles between accidents than those without these devices.

What may be more worrying to some drivers is that the government predicts that there will be 3 million speeding convictions, due to the increase in safety cameras. So to protect you and your car, RAC Trackstar offers Safe Speed, an optional service that alerts you to the accident blackspots and safety cameras.

* The RAC Trackstar Safe Speed option alerts you when you approach zones monitored by fixed safety cameras, variable safety cameras and multi-camera detectors (also known as Specs)


* There are three audible alert stages. Three beeps warn you as you approach a monitored zone, followed by five beeps immediately before you enter the zone. These beeps remind you to concentrate on the road ahead, and give you enough time to correct your speed.


* If you continue driving over the limit through the zone, continuous beeps warn you until your speed falls below the limit.


* The system is operational on every journey, helping to give extra peace of mind


* Safe Speed service is provided free of charge for three months if you pay your tracking subscription by Direct Debit
